Einstein did pretty well in school, yet he was a quiet child. He was a Jew, yet at the age of 6, attended a Catholic school. He was at first very interested in sciences of his father's compass, where ever he turned it always turned North! He was a bright and quiet child to grow up to be one of the most famous scientists of all time.

Albert Einstein's childhood was marred by difficulties at school due to his rebellious nature and disagreements with authority figures. However, he found solace in his supportive family environment and discovered his passion for science and mathematics at an early age. Overall, his childhood was a mix of challenges and moments of joy.
